While using the server, we have confirmed that the clock speed is very low only for a specific CPU group. Could you please tell me the cause and solution for this?
All cpu's cpuinfo_min_freq and cpuinfo_max_freq are (1500, 2000). Also, the scaling driver is acpi-cpufreq, and the policy is ondemand.
0-63,128-191 CPUs clock speed shows 1500MHz, but others show 400MHz even if we use them 100% usage.
